Job Summary
Functions as a technical specialist in Mechanical Engineering. Under general supervision, performs all aspects of conventional design engineering and analysis. Broadens knowledge and skill set in area of discipline. May start to expand knowledge in other disciplines and/or functional areas.
Key Responsibilities
General Responsibilities:
Engineering Standards: Continues to learn and remains current on departmental design guides, standards, systems, applicable engineering codes and B&V policies and procedures. Applies to assigned tasks as appropriate.
Quality / Continuous Improvement: Begins to independently apply knowledge and complies with B&V quality program relative to assigned tasks.
Supports continuous improvement and change management efforts.
Project Execution Responsibilities:
Engineering Production: Prepares a variety of moderately complex engineering deliverables. Performs complex research and develops recommendations for equipment and/or materials selection. Collects, assimilates, and manages data for engineering work. Prepares complex engineering calculations following standard methods and principles. Understands and adheres to budget, schedule, and quality requirements. Recognizes, defines and resolves problems within assigned area. May provide direction and guidance to others.
Project Coordination: Assigns tasks to and coordinate details of the work.
Client Focus: Actively seeks to understand client interests and drivers through normal client contact and through interaction and communication with project leadership. Applies understanding of client interests and drivers to their own behavior and performance of the work under his/her responsibility. May provide support to business development or pursuit activities.
Technical Expertise:
Knowledge Sharing, Innovation and Technology: Shares current knowledge of latest technology and processes.

Minimum Qualifications
Requires a bachelor's degree in engineering from either a recognized accredited program in their home country or the country in which the professional is practicing.
Minimum of 3 years related work experience.
All applicants must be able to complete pre-employment onboarding requirements (if selected) which may include any/all of the following: criminal/civil background check, drug screen, and motor vehicle records search, in compliance with any applicable laws and regulations.
Certifications
Completion of engineering training program is preferred.
